Rare Gothic revival church crucifix and a wonderful hand crafted work of religious art. Made and marked by Brom, Utrecht (see image 17). Brom of Utrecht was a family (or dynasty) of goldsmiths in the Dutch city of Utrecht and they were known for creating some of the best ecclesiastical art that was available in the second half of the 19th and in the first half of the 20th century (from 1856 to 1961 to be exact). They were both designers and manufacturers and, as it goes with truly good makers, they also attracted the interest of other top designers from that era. Those other top designers needed a company to handcraft their top quality designs and Brom of Utrecht was one of the 'go-to' companies for many decades. Those designers were Steph Uiterwaal, Jos Pinker, Wilfried Put, Jo Uiterwaal and Maarten Zwollo. Crucifix on Calvary, called 'Pestis Christi' or Crucifiix Pestis 'Plague of Christ' or Plague Crucifix). The sculpture is composite, made with heterogeneous materials: wax, wood, papier-mâché. The octagonal base is slightly raised and supports the calvary, symbolized by rocks, from which the crucifix rises, made with intentionally unfinished boards and with marked veins. The depicted Christ is peculiar: he shows scarified skin all over his body. Masterfully crafted in wax. They are the plagues of the plague that Christ, 'Agnus Dei' takes charge of with salvific value, for the salvation of the world. At his feet the ordeal full of symbols: evil (snake) with the apple, the 'Memento mori' of human bones...
